Formal Dining Rooms: Elegant Decorating Ideas
A formal dining room is a space designed for special occasions, family gatherings, and entertaining guests. It is a room where elegant decor and ambiance create a sophisticated atmosphere. Decorating a formal dining room requires careful planning and consideration of factors such as furniture, lighting, and accessories.
Furniture
The centerpiece of any formal dining room is the dining table. Choose a table that is large enough to accommodate your guests comfortably while also providing ample space for serving dishes and centerpieces. Opt for a classic style such as a rectangular or oval table made from high-quality materials like mahogany or walnut. 搭配 upholstered dining chairs with comfortable cushioning and intricate details to enhance the elegance of the space.
A sideboard or buffet is another essential piece of furniture for a formal dining room. It provides additional storage space for dishes, silverware, and linens, while also serving as a decorative accent. Choose a sideboard that complements the style of the dining table and features intricate carvings or moldings.
Lighting
Lighting plays a crucial role in creating the ambiance of a formal dining room. Opt for a combination of natural and artificial light to illuminate the space evenly. Large windows or skylights can provide ample natural light during the day, while a chandelier or pendant light suspended above the dining table will create a focal point in the evening.
Consider installing wall sconces or recessed lighting to provide additional illumination without overwhelming the room. Dimmable lights allow you to adjust the brightness to create different moods and settings.
Accessories
Accessories add personality and style to a formal dining room. A large mirror placed above the sideboard can reflect light and create the illusion of space. Display artwork or family portraits on the walls to create a personal touch. Choose accessories such as vases, candlesticks, and sculptures that complement the overall decor and add a touch of sophistication.
Table linens are an important element of a formal dining room. Choose high-quality tablecloths, napkins, and placemats in neutral colors such as white, cream, or ivory. Add a touch of color or pattern with a runner or centerpiece.
Color Palette
The color palette for a formal dining room should be sophisticated and timeless. Neutral colors such as beige, gray, and white provide a classic backdrop for elegant furnishings and accessories. Consider adding pops of color through accent pieces such as artwork, vases, or upholstery.
Textiles
Textiles play a significant role in creating the ambiance of a formal dining room. Choose fabrics that are luxurious and durable, such as velvet, silk, or damask. Use these fabrics for upholstery, curtains, and table linens to add texture and depth to the space.
Lay down a rug under the dining table to define the area and add warmth. Choose a rug with a subtle pattern or texture that complements the overall decor.
